Neil Mulholland's yard at Limpley Stoke has had a strong season with sixty winners to their name, and Gata Ban slots into that pattern as a solid contributor. The horse typically races in Class 5 events, where it has won 2 of 9 races—a 22% win rate at that level that suggests it is genuinely competitive when pitched against the right opposition. Recent form has been mixed but not discouraging: two wins in the last six races, including a victory at Fontwell Park just over two months ago on June 10th. The most recent outing, just a day ago, saw it finish fourth, so it remains actively campaigned and evidently sound enough to race regularly.
Richie McLernon has been Gata Ban's most frequent partner in the saddle, riding it seven times for two wins—a 29% win rate that edges above the horse's overall average. That suggests the pairing has found a winning formula on occasion, even if results have not been consistent. At nine years old, Gata Ban is not a young prospect, but it is a horse that seems to have found its natural level and keeps competing at it. The win at Taunton on December 21st, 2022, marked the start of a career that has been quietly productive rather than spectacular: steady, useful, and still active enough to line up again.
